import { PromiseAuditApi } from "https://deno.land/x/windmill@v1.38.0/windmill-api/types/PromiseAPI.ts";
Constructors
new
PromiseAuditApi(configuration: Configuration,
requestFactory?: AuditApiRequestFactory,
responseProcessor?: AuditApiResponseProcessor,
Properties
private
api: ObservableAuditApiMethods
getAuditLog(): Promise<AuditLog>
get audit log (requires admin privilege)
listAuditLogs(): Promise<Array<AuditLog>>
workspace: string,
page?: number,
perPage?: number,
before?: Date,
after?: Date,
username?: string,
operation?: string,
resource?: string,
actionKind?: ,
| "Create"
| "Update"
| "Delete"
| "Execute"
_options?: Configuration,
list audit logs (requires admin privilege)